Teaching All of California's Children Well: Teachers and Teaching to Close the Achievement Gap
Author: Maxwell-Jolly, J. & Gándara, P.
Publisher: CDE & CAP-Ed
Publication Date: 2008, April
Summary or Abstract: Meeting the needs of diverse students is clearly a major challenge for California's educators, and understanding the ways that diversity affects classroom learning and students' adaptation to school are key aspects of this challenge. This paper examines the importance of teacher expertise in the instruction of diverse students, challenges to measuring teacher effectiveness, the unequal distribution of high quality teachers, and the challenges of preparing effective teachers to meet the needs of all students in California. The authors conclude with recommendations for the recruitment, preparation and distribution of qualified teachers to make a difference in the academic outcomes for groups of students who currently underperform at significant levels.
